For a week or so I really wanted to write down a list with all the good things I want to gift myself. I use to shop a lot, but I am very bad at shopping for wellness for myself. Easily few months or years can pass by before I step into any wellness centre to give myself a nice treat. Few months ago I got a wellness giftcard from my brother on my birthday and I went to one hour really nice hotstone massage and have forgot everything about wellness since that day.
So in this new year I have a plan to give myself nice treats like...
* a massage
* a facial
* a manicure & pedicure
...each month!

When calculating the cost it is an amount which most of us can afford. Still we neglect ourselves. But not anymore.

I like the old way of budgetting with coloured envelopes. So from this month end, coloured envelopes with money for the specific categories will be nicely arranged on the shelf. And a category will be "Treats for Sangee" to cover the above list :) wont it be nice?
